Zoneminder api python github. xn--p1ai/cm8tyl/music-mp3-download-app-free-download.
Broadly speaking the iterations were as follows: Dec 1, 2020 · I have tested the link to my ZoneMinder using a Python script and the same module used by HA to connect and retrieve an image URL from zoneminder, which when viewed in the browser displays correctly The text was updated successfully, but these errors were encountered: Add this topic to your repo. zmha-py forked from rohankapoorcom/zm-py latest release 0. 34, pyzm is now ZoneMinder CCTV plugin for XBMC. Description of problem: I use zoneminder to manage my IP cameras and if one of them become offline, zoneminder start to consume a lot of CPU so i wrote a pair of automations to disable/enable the camera by changing it's function to None and back to Monitor. ZoneMinder RPM Database Init . Manage code changes Version of ZoneMinder: 1. 0-kali4-amd64 #1 SMP Debian 4. py at develop · rohankapoorcom/zm-py Apr 2, 2017 · Zoneminder will not load anymore. A loose python wrapper around the ZoneMinder REST API - zm-py/zoneminder/zm. Locate and click the :guilabel:`System` tab link. yaml entries and steps to reproduce: Unauthenticated RCE in ZoneMinder Snapshots - Poc Exploit - rvizx/CVE-2023-26035 GitHub community articles Python 100. Other than that you only need to set a few things in the script to customise it for your set up. With features such as object detection, motion detection, face recognition and more, it gives you the power to keep an eye on your home, office or any other place you want to monitor. 46. 0 APIs, you have an additional option right below it: OPT_USE_LEGACY_API_AUTH which is enabled by default. this will have all the fields with the most recent value thereon t='tf' is sent for fields that have changed. From home-assistant. ZoneMinder API. You switched accounts on another tab or window. json via API, it will return 500 Internal Server More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. 2 Component/platform: zoneminder Description of problem: Home Assistant logs errors about tracebacks while trying to handle a Zoneminder Mar 21, 2018 · Python release (python3 --version): Python 3. sh working The text was updated successfully, but these errors were encountered: Nov 28, 2020 · Saved searches Use saved searches to filter your results more quickly SMARTAPI-PYTHON. 0%; Footer Simple script (and docker container) to push some zoneminder metrics to InfluxDB. Add this topic to your repo. I don't have an issue, but this capability looks like what I would like in my setup using v1. It supports both the legacy and new token based API, as well as ZM logs/ZM shared memory support. 2004 (Core)- Browser name and version (if this is an issue with the web interface) If the issue concerns a camera It doesn't. Personen und Gesichtserkennung mit Zoneminder, OpenCV (GPU), YOLO, cuDNN und CUDA - wiegehtki/zoneminder-jetson Aug 3, 2019 · Due to wrong python version. ZoneMinder appliance includes all the standard features in `TurnKey Core To associate your repository with the tiktok-downloader topic, visit your repo's landing page and select "manage topics. Description of problem: Updating to 0. On other systems install the Nvidia docker, see here. Expected: Zoneminder starts normally as it does in 0. ZoneMinder development team will take on the support of zmNinja and provision of notification services going forward. If that is correct, you might need to first login to web console with the user ID so that the passwords are migrated to bcrypt. 2 Oct 17, 2020. 36. A good example of who may use this is Home Assistant. learning. Sep 21, 2017 · You signed in with another tab or window. It allows rapid trading algo development easily, with support for both REST and streaming data interfaces. learning development by creating an account on GitHub. To associate your repository with the zoneminder topic, visit your repo's landing page and select "manage topics. - GitHub - m3m0o/zoneminder-snapshots-rce-poc: This is a script written in Python that allows the exploitation of the Zoneminder's security flaw described in CVE-2023-26035. 17-04-19 13:00:42 ERROR (MainThread) [homeassistant. JavaScript 100. However Zoneminder integration will not longer start or load in HA. PyGitHub is a Python library to access the GitHub REST API . Historical sources and authorship information is available as part of the Home Assistant project: Sep 17, 2019 · Navigation Menu Toggle navigation. All reactions May 2, 2023 · Hey there @rohankapoorcom, mind taking a look at this issue as it has been labeled with an integration (zoneminder) you are listed as a code owner for? Thanks! Code owner commands. All 49 Python 16 Shell 7 Dockerfile 6 JavaScript java docker raspberry-pi spring-boot gradle rest-api zoneminder Languages. Zoneminder is working fine all functions are working as expected. Contribute to dhamonex/zoneminder-rpm-database-init development by creating an account on GitHub. A loose python wrapper around the ZoneMinder REST API Mar 1, 2015 · Re: pyzm: a python wrapper (leverages 1. Extracting Private Repositories of a Logged-in User Feb 10, 2018 · Python release (python3 --version): 3. 5. 22. If you are using Unraid, install the Nvidia plugin and follow these instructions. GitHub is where people build software. 3. ZM 1. Latest version. I’m the developer for the ZoneMinder Event Server/machine learning hooks and zmNinja. The big advantage is mlapi only loads the model(s) once and keeps them in memory, greatly reducing total time for You signed in with another tab or window. ) face recognition; deep license plate recognition; I will add more algorithms over time. A tag already exists with the provided branch name. zmNinja Public. A loose python wrapper around the ZoneMinder REST API Feb 11, 2020 · Not only did I want an API wrapper, but I also wanted to be able to tap into ZoneMinder’s logging system, Shared Memory and the Event server. " GitHub is where people build software. Jul 21, 2020 · The text was updated successfully, but these errors were encountered: More than 100 million people use GitHub to discover, fork, and contribute to over 330 million projects. entity] Update for camera. 4 I am now getting the following exception for both my cameras, prior to this there was no issues. After 1. - GitHub - rkjeevan30/smart-zoneminder-vms: Fast object detection, face recognition and S3 upload of ZoneMinder alarms. Component/platform: Camera/Zoneminder. 30. 3. I am running Zoneminder 1. Component/platform: ZoneMinder. 6 Hooks version python -c "import zmes_hook_helpers as h; print (h. Component/platform: zoneminder. python3 -mvenv venv && source venv/bin/activate && pip install opencv-python requests imutils python3 stream. SMARTAPI-PYTHON is a Python library for interacting with Angel's Trading platform ,that is a set of REST-like HTTP APIs that expose many capabilities required to build stock market investment and trading platforms. To associate your repository with the edge-tpu topic, visit your repo's landing page and select "manage topics. The big advantage is mlapi only loads the model(s) once and keeps them in memory, greatly reducing total time for This script is a nice, simple and adaptable solution to bridging between the ZoneMinder app and your cameras' motion detection engine. pl facility which needs to be enabled on the settings page of the ZoneMinder app. There may be a weird bug where the very first page you see when opening HTTP://<ZM IP>/zm keeps re-opening and never letting you get to the ZM web GUI ZoneMinder Scripts. You signed out in another tab or window. Contribute to liamshanny/zm-timelapse-cli development by creating an account on GitHub. 4. Reload to refresh your session. Apr 2, 2020 · Or perhaps you need to use the Gmail API in Python to automate tasks related to your Gmail account. A lot of folks who come by my GitHub repos seem to use ZM with HA. For example. " Fast object detection, face recognition and S3 upload of ZoneMinder alarms. 0%. zoneminder development by creating an account on GitHub. Aug 2, 2019 · Hi there, new to the HA community. yaml zoneminder: ssl: True host: localhost username: user_name password: pass_word sensor: - platform: zonemi Saved searches Use saved searches to filter your results more quickly GitHub is where people build software. It uses the zmtrigger. PHP 5k 1. Actually it was your previous comment. Jan 20, 2020 · Nope. UPDATE 8:55 PM 4/18/2018: I gave up on trying to figure out syslog/logrotate and just running tail -F --retry on the normal /var/log/zm/* pathmy script would stop working every time the log file rotated. Python+Flask. This allows you to edit the script file and click on "Reset" so that your modifications are taken into account by ZoneMinder. Acknowledgments. Self-hosted, local only NVR and AI Computer Vision software. 04. May 29, 2022 · In this case inserting the eventid (received from mqtt topic zoneminder/1$. however once running the Example on the README. Also works with ZMES! - Releases · ZoneMinder/mlapi Jan 18, 2023 · Console interface to control your ZoneMinder video surveillance system - GitHub - montagdude/zoneminder-controlcenter: Console interface to control your ZoneMinder video surveillance system Skip to content Jun 16, 2019 · I was wondering if anyone wanted to help out rewriting zoneminder in python and cleaning up alot of the poorly implemented 'features' and bugs? This is a great project, but it needs some direction. This is a script written in Python that allows the exploitation of the Zoneminder's security flaw described in CVE-2023-26035. When the variable is set to 1, the "Reset" button in ZoneMinder will reload the script instead of calibrating the camera position. 04 LTS Browser name and version: N/A API Version: 2. To check if APIs are enabled, visit Options->System. Absolutely no plans to retire. Thus pyzm was born, and with ZM 1. rst at master · SteveGilvarry/ZoneMi Python3 script to process zoneminder alarms with YOLO4 in realtime - lbdc/zm-alarm Nov 25, 2021 · Zoneminder + Zm Event Notification Server Docker. Documentation is here. Fixes [ #3643] Add a sleeping flag so that when we get sigterm, we can just exit instead of returning to the sleep. As of today, it supports: detection of 80 types of objects (persons, cars, etc. API Wrappers pyzm is a python wrapper for the ZoneMinder APIs. The problem solving was similar. ZoneMinder API, Logger and other base utilities for python programmers. If OPT_USE_API is enabled, your APIs are active. Contribute to dlandon/zoneminder. See its project site for more details. This library enables you to manage GitHub resources such as repositories, user profiles, and organizations in your Python applications. This will pull the zoneminder docker image. The API is built in CakePHP and lives under the /api directory. 34. zmNinja website. Be sure your container can see the graphics card. Contribute to MauricinhoMorales/Zoneminder development by creating an account on GitHub. Contribute to davglass/zoneminder-api development by creating an account on GitHub. Version of ZoneMinder: v1. 42. zm-py is based on code that was originally part of Home Assistant . JavaScript 999 263. api-server. To associate your repository with the vms topic, visit your repo's landing page and select "manage topics. The goal is to restore Home Assistant functionality with the current ZoneMinder 1. Description of problem: Zoneminder doesn't start and generates errors. Jun 17, 2018 · I have dealt with this although I used arduino devices not python.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. Broadly speaking the iterations were as follows: May 21, 2017 · Home Assistant release (hass --version): 0. An API can be thought of as an instruction manual for communication between multiple software apparatuses. Contribute to markhoney/plugin.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. At the top of Console display click on the :guilabel:`Options` menu link. eventid) so that the still image is a specific still image from zoneminder and not the last available from the camera. 34 The text was updated successfully, but these errors were encountered: ZoneMinder is a free, open source Closed-circuit television software application developed for Linux which supports IP, USB and Analog cameras. Not nice but works Im able to object detect on livefeed with opencv and yolov4 in python (0,5)fps on 1080p stream with ~15-25% CPU and very low GPU load (gpu hardware acceleration is on). Before I start, can you provide any information about using it on this version of ZoneMinder? Thanks alpaca-trade-api-python. py does not do local inferencing. pip install pyzm. For v2. More than 94 million people use GitHub to discover, fork, and contribute to over 330 million projects. ZoneMinder - Video Surveillance. 34 features) by asker » Wed Jan 22, 2020 1:09 am. Contribute to brentahughes/GoZone development by creating an account on GitHub. zoneminder Public. I created a whole new home assistant user and password combo in my zoneminder install, granted it authority to use the api, and everything started working!! Apr 19, 2017 · Python release (python3 --version): Python 3. 36 deployments by providing bug fixes and refactoring with upstream's API changes. Fix missing/corrupted pre-alarm frames in recording. 33 and beyond use a better API system (via tokens) as well as May 18, 2019 · Event Server version latests from git pull yesterday and today. Integration: Zoneminder. ZoneMinder does offer a streaming video API that can be used to view the event with the alarm frames via a web browser. Once it is installed you are ready to run the docker container. There is a bit of explanation on the use of these things in the repo, check the source for more information. machine. ZoneMinder comes with APIs enabled. Sep 4, 2020 · Installing collected packages: opencv-contrib-python Successfully installed opencv-contrib-python-4. 64. Feb 24, 2023 · You signed in with another tab or window. Speeds up zoneminder shutdown. Problem-relevant configuration. 0 The documentation recommends refreshing an access token prior to it expiring. 9. Jan 23, 2024 · pyzm 0. 33 change login their plugin broke and we started receiving help requests A loose Python wrapper of ZoneMinder's API for the Home Assistant Integration. If that is not an issue, try creating a new user in ZM and testing with zmNinja with that user. Description of problem: Patched ZM host machine (Ubuntu 18. 6. 2. However the Alexa VideoApp Interface that's used to playback the alarm clip requires very specific formats which are not supported by the ZoneMinder streaming API. 62. video. Zoneminder Darknet yolov2 tiny Hack Post by operat0r » Fri Jan 19, 2018 9:24 am. For details of each API behavior, please see the online API document. H265 80-90% CPU. In this tutorial, you will learn how you can use GitHub API v3 in Python using both requests or PyGithub libraries. I recently setup HA and realized the existing integration uses legacy approach to ZM. dev0 Python release (python3 --version): Python 3. Mar 5, 2019 · I can view the thumbnail of my ZoneMinder cameras: But clicking on them to view the full sized image shows a broken image: Right-clicking on an image and opening it in a new tab gives me a 401: Unauthorized message that appears to come from HA and not from ZoneMinder (as a login attempt is logged in Home Assistant): Zoneminder api client written in golang. zmNinja is a multi platform (iOS, Android, Windows Desktop, Mac Desktop, Linux Desktop) client for ZoneMinder users. Table of content: Getting User Data; Getting Repositories of a User. Locate the TIMEZONE parameter and use the pulldown menu to locate your Timezone. 2k. I was not able to get hardware acceleration for ffmpeg running so I have to deal with running @ 10fps on CPU. In an effort to further ‘open up’ ZoneMinder, an API was needed. How you installed ZoneMinder: RPMFusion. These are wrappers so they will wrap around core ZM functionality (triggers are core). A full-featured, open source, state-of-the-art video surveillance software system. It uses /bin/sh syntax, so can run in anything supporting sh (and the binaries and parameters used). 4 as newer releases may have longer lasting API keys that you can create from web portal. This may necessitate new app names due to some app store policies. x is now installed. Apr 8, 2024 · Saved searches Use saved searches to filter your results more quickly Oct 12, 2022 · A tag already exists with the provided branch name. Full name and version of OS: CentOS Linux release 8. 3 LTS. garage fails Traceback (most recent Oct 20, 2021 · Alright! ZoneMinder 1. ZoneMinder is a free, open source Closed-circuit television software application developed for Linux which supports IP, USB and Analog cameras. The Timezone can be changed using the following steps. Enabling API. - GitHub - ancker010/zoneminder-to-influxdb: Simple script (and docker container) to push some zoneminder metrics t Fixes [ #3510] Stop streams when clicking cancel/Save so that we don't log errors trying to access a dead zms. Not to be confused with ZoneMinder's Pythonic wrapper pyzm , this zm-py project (with a hyphen) is tailored for the Home Assistant ZoneMinder Integration. A loose python wrapper around the ZoneMinder REST API - fabaff/zmha-py Worlds most popular free, scalable and featured CCTV NVR solution - ZoneMinder Feb 7, 2020 · It seems like you recently updated to 1. My OS is Kali (Debian based 4. md provided with the Python script (and Docker container) to connect to ZoneMinder API and set date/time on all monitors via ONVIF - GitHub - jantman/zondeminder-onvif-date-time-setter: Python script (and Docker container) to connect to ZoneMinder API and set date/time on all monitors via ONVIF Apr 9, 2021 · The ZoneMinder API script is currently mostly used to get monitor status data to find cameras which have stopped streaming (through the camwatch script) for a given interval, upon which they are reset using the cam script. py testvideo. 2 Setup in configuration. 3 LTS) to all latest patches. Copy PIP instructions. When run in this mode, zm_detect. This script doesn't have any dependency. 9 The version of ZoneMinder you are using: You are Install the docker container by going to a command line and enter the command: docker pull dlandon/zoneminder. version)" 3. After you confirm the graphics card is seen by the Zoneminder docker container, you can then compile opencv with GPU support. We should install python3-pip and run pip3 install and add module pyzmutils and requests in order to have /usr/bin/detect_wrapper. log. The goal of this script is to search for possible Privilege Escalation Paths (tested in Debian, CentOS, FreeBSD, OpenBSD and MacOS). This will allow quick integration with and development of ZoneMinder. API evolution The ZoneMinder API has evolved over time. 5 How you installed ZoneMinder: PPA Full name and version of OS: Ubuntu 18. Nov 8, 2019 · Ubuntu 18. Describe the bug When targeting monitor. By extracting the implementation and relinquishing data into objects, an API simplifies programming. Overview ¶. Instead if invokes an API call to mlapi. By default, linpeas won't write anything to disk and won't try to login Add this topic to your repo To associate your repository with the zoneminder topic, visit your repo's landing page and select "manage topics. helpers. Sign in Jun 6, 2017 · as it stands im not sure if this is a problem with my python programming or if this is a problem with the library. mp4 - this should display the test video with objects identified About An easy to use/extend object recognition API you can locally install. 0. alpaca-trade-api-python is a python library for the Alpaca Commission Free Trading API . 30-1kali1 (2017-06-06) x86_64 GNU/Linux) after running the install using pip install onvif I fired up the python console and imported the library. . A loose python wrapper around the ZoneMinder REST API One of the key uses of mlapi is to act as an API gateway for zm_detect, the ML python process for zmeventnotification. Released: Jan 23, 2024. I created a whole new home assistant user and password combo in my zoneminder install, granted it authority to use the api, and everything started working!! Write better code with AI Code review. Monitor your home, office, or wherever you want. The text was updated successfully, but these errors were encountered: Jul 16, 2020 · Zoneminder timelapse generator. Before you run the image, feel free to read the configuration section below to customize various settings. High performance, cross platform ionic app for Home/Commerical Security Surveillance using ZoneMinder. First off, the cookies management may not be required in ZM > 1. It provides a RESTful service and supports CRUD (create, retrieve, update, delete) functions for Monitors, Events, Frames, Zones Zoneminder Docker. It lets you execute orders in real time. Using off the shelf hardware with any camera, you can design a system as large or as small as you need. 1. May 9, 2021 · Now you can reload the script easily by clicking the "Reset" buttons inside ZoneMinder. For example, an API may be used for database communication between web applications. - ZoneMinder/api. . The Options window opens. Code owners of zoneminder can trigger bot actions by commenting: @home-assistant close Closes the issue. One of the key uses of mlapi is to act as an API gateway for zm_detect, the ML python process for zmeventnotification. Additionally I wanted to show only the alarm frames and not The Event Notification Server sits along with ZoneMinder and offers real time notifications, support for push notifications as well as Machine Learning powered recognition. rtsp surveillance tensorflow ip-camera nvr cuda motion-detection yolo face-recognition object subscribe ( [instruments]) send a list of instruments to watch, feed_type specifies the type of data requested ( t=touchline d=depth) t='tk' is sent once on subscription for each instrument. @home-assistant rename Awesome new title Renames the issue. zl aj gy gv eh dv tf bp fo bb